St. Petersburg will receive 19.8 billion rubles. transport infrastructure to the 2018 World Cup football – BBC

St. Petersburg Governor Georgy Poltavchenko said that the federal budget will allocate 19.8 billion rubles for the construction in St. Petersburg transport infrastructure for the World Cup in 2018.

«This viaduct interchange at Pulkovo Highway intersection with the Danube Avenue and a portion of the Neva-Vasileostrovskaya subway line from the station “Maritime” station “Savushkina”, including the station “Novokrestovskaya.

Recently, we again evaluated our options to suit different scenarios and challenges in the economy. And they came to the conclusion that for the smooth conduct of the World Cup would be enough for the projects that we have run in road infrastructure or run in the next, and in 2016. I mean dedicated lanes for passenger vehicles from the Pulkovo airport to the metro station “Moskovskaya” Pulkovo highway interchanges-Danube Avenue to the “Star”. Need to expand the highway near the railway bridge. These works are planned in cooperation with Russian Railways “- the words Poltavchenko « R-Sport ».

For four years, these objects from the federal budget will allocate 19.8 billion rubles, of which 14 billion – for the construction of the subway, 5.8 billion – for the construction of interchanges.
